Huge news for Veterans now living in Texas!

The VA Team at United Lending would like to announce that effective today, December 21, 2010, the Texas Veterans Land Board has dropped the one-year residency requirement for their programs! Therefore, Home of Record is no longer considered. Per the press release today, you are considered a “Texas Veteran” if you are a veteran living in Texas at the time of application, it’s that simple. (The one exception is active duty members currently serving in Texas who will still need to change their legal residency to Texas before applying, but they can do that their first day in Texas.) Thank you Commissioner Jerry Patterson for making this huge improvement to your veteran programs! If you are wondering what programs are available to Texas Veterans, please visit their website at  www.texasveterans.com The most commonly used program is the Texas Veterans Housing Assistance Program. The sole purpose is to give Texas Veterans a below market interest rate. For Texas veterans with a 30% or greater disability rating, that rate could be significantly below the market rate. Dropping the residency requirement makes this program available to many more veterans who are in Texas now, but have not been here for the last 12 months.
